    Lots to do up there! We go every year and always find new stuff, the train from hill city to keystone is cool, cosmos, rushmore, custer park etc. we did the crazy horse thing and its cool to do once but once was enough. We stayed at the flinstones camp ground in custer one year and went to the museum and old court house and that was cool. Rapid city has lots of stuff to see and do as well.

    I'll just go ahead and second everything that's already been said. Spearfish Canyon and Sturgis Canyon are pretty drives. The Homestake Mine in Lead is a big ass hole in the ground that is worth seeing. Devil's Tower in Hulett, WY is a nice stop as well. Be sure to grab a beer at Crow Peak Brewing in Spearfish.

    I lived in the Black Hills for 10 years so I'm pretty biased about it.
